BlueSky

BlueSky - A framework for predicting fire and smoke effects that integrates components for fuel load fuel moisture fuel consumption emissions dispersion/trajectories Developed and managed by the USDA

Forest Service, Pacific Northwest Research Station, AirFIRE team.

Page 21: Current Research in Smoke Modeling Scott Goodrick U.S. Forest Service Southern Research Station Athens, GA.

BlueSky

Designed as a tool to aid prescribed fire managers in making go/no-go decisions with regard to smoke management

Provides hourly surface PM2.5 concentrations and smoke plume trajectories depicting direction and height of the plume
